[PATCH] ALSA: hda/realtek: Fixup ft alc257 rename alc3328

Takashi Iwai tiwai at suse.de
Mon Jun 16 00:53:28 PDT 2025


On Mon, 16 Jun 2025 09:45:20 +0200,
wangdicheng wrote:
> 
> Audio ALC3328 recognized as ALC257, updated PCI ID0x10EC12F0 to rename it to 3328
> 
> Signed-off-by: wangdicheng <wangdicheng at kylinos.cn>

Try to fix up via either rename_tbl[] or rename_pci_tbl[] instead.


thanks,

Takashi
